值MySQL ID最大值探究(mysqlid最大)

MySQL是一种开源的关系型数据库管理系统,它可以用于管理各种不同类型的数据。MySQL中有一个概念叫做ID最大值。ID最大值是指在数据库表中,单条记录最大的编号(主键值)。

那么MySQL中ID最大值是多少呢?MySQL中ID最大值根据所使用字段类型确定。

例如,如果使用MySQL中最常见的int类型,那么ID最大值就是整数或“signed longint”,也就是2 ^ 31-1,即2147483647(大于2147483647就会报错)。如果使用longlong类型,那么ID最大值就是2 ^ 63-1,即9223372036854775807(大于9223372036854775807就会报错)。

另外,如果使用MySQL中char(n)类型,那么ID最大值就是整数或“string”,也就是n字节(最高可以是65535)。

如果想要确定MySQL中ID最大值,可以使用下面的语句:

SELECT MAX(my_column_name) FROM my_table_name;

或者也可以使用这段代码:

SELECT IF(MAX(my_column_name) > 2147483647, ‘signed longint’, ‘int’) FROM my_table_name;

这样就可以得出确切的ID最大值了。

总之,MySQL中ID最大值的大小与所使用的字段类型有关,如果要确定ID最大值,需要通过查询或者代码来确定。其实MySQL中ID最大值大小的确定很重要,在实际应用中,可以根据ID最大值来限制表中数据记录的个数。


数据运维技术 » 值MySQL ID最大值探究(mysqlid最大)